Temple McLean

Founder of Billings Mediation Center and Conflict Resilience Project at Yellowstone County Justice Court

Practitioner Mediator · Certified Mediator Trainer

Founder of Billings Mediation Center and Conflict Resilience Project at Yellowstone County Justice Court. Executive Director of Certified Facilitative Mediators Association (CFMA). Graduate Certificate in Contemporary Dispute Resolution (Carter School of Peace and Resolution). Certified additionally in family mediation and eldercare mediation issues within and outside of elder living facilities. Certified Mediator Trainer and CDP-I Assessment Practitioner. Colson Fellow.
